Duluth, MN vs Salem, OR
Cost of Living Comparison
Duluth, MN is more affordable by 14.9 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Duluth, MN | Salem, OR |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 88.8 | 103.6 | -14.9 |
| Housing | 71.1 | 110.3 | -39.2 |
| Goods | 95.3 | 105.3 | -10.0 |
| Utilities | 87.3 | 104.7 | -17.4 |
| Other Services | 92.2 | 100.3 | -8.1 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Duluth, MN | Salem, OR |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$67,612 | $72,154 |
| Median Home Value | $193,600 | $358,700 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$909 | $1,227 |
| Per Capita Income | $37,319 | $34,631 |
